9600 baud is about a screen per second of text
A 9600 "baud" connection is a little less than 1K per second. That's about 1 screen full of human text on an 80x24 terminal every second. ... Really, if every line was filled solid that's about one full screen every 2 seconds. Typical text for humans averages using only 1/2 the screen.
16550 UART
16550 UART chips can handle up to 115.2 kbit/s (115200 bps)
Bandwidth comparisons
kbps = kbit/s = kbits per second = thousand bits per second
MBps = MByte/s = MByte per second = megabytes per second
Connection | Bits per second | Bytes per second | Real World Expected Throughput | |
---|---|---|---|---|
TTY (V.18) | 0.045 kbit/s | TTY uses a Baudot_code code, not ASCII. This uses 5 bits per character instead of 8, plus one start and 1.5 stop bits (7.5 total bits per character sent). | 6 characters per second | |
Modem 300 (300 baud) (Bell 103 or V.21) | 0.3 kbit/s | 0.03 kB/s (30 characters per second ~ about reading speed) | ||
serial 9600 8N1 (close to V.32 9600 baud) | 9.6 kbit/s (10 bits per word) |
0.96 kB/s (960 Bytes/s) | ||
Modem 56k (V.92) | 56.0/48.0 kbit/s | 5.6/4.8 kB/s | ||
serial 57600 8N1 | 57.6 kbit/s (10 bits per word) |
5.76 kB/s (5760 Bytes/s) | ||
serial 115200 8N1 | 115.2 kbit/s (10 bits per word) |
11.52 kB/s (11520 Bytes/s) | ||
DS1/T1 | 1.544 Mbit/s | 0.192 MB/s | ||
T2 | 6.312 Mbit/s | 0.789 MB/s | ||
T3 | 44.736 Mbit/s | 5.5925 MB/s | ||
OC1 | 51.84 Mbit/s | 6.48 MB/s | ||
OC3 | 155.52 Mbit/s | 19.44 MB/s | ||
Ethernet (10base-X) | 10 Mbit/s | 1.25 MB/s | 6 Mbit/s (0.75 MB/s) | |
Fast Ethernet (100base-X) | 100 Mbit/s | 12.5 MB/s | 60 Mbit/s (7.50 MB/s) | |
Gigabit Ethernet (1000base-X) | 1000 Mbit/s | 125 MB/s | 600 Mbit/s (75 MB/s) | |
Bluetooth 2.0+EDR | 3 Mbit/s | 0.375 MB/s | ||
802.11b | 11.0 Mbit/s | 1.375 MB/s | ||
802.11a | 54.0 Mbit/s | 6.75 MB/s | ||
802.11g | 54.0 Mbit/s | 6.75 MB/s | ||
802.11n | 248.0 Mbit/s | 31 MB/s | ||
PCI 32-bit/33 MHz | 1067 Mbit/s | 133.33 MB/s | ||
PCI 64-bit/100 MHz | 6399 Mbit/s | 800 MB/s | ||
Serial ATA (SATA-150) | 1500 Mbit/s | 187.5 MB/s | ||
Serial ATA (SATA-300) | 3000 Mbit/s | 375 MB/s | ||
Serial Attached SCSI (SAS) | 3000 Mbit/s | 375 MB/s | ||
RS-232 Serial max | 0.2304 Mbit/s | 0.0288 MB/s | ||
USB 2.0 (USB Hi-Speed) | 480 Mbit/s | 60 MB/s | ||
eSATA (SATA 300) | 2400 Mbit/s | 300 MB/s | ||
USB 3.0 | 4.80 Gbit/s | 600 MB/s | ||
PC2100 DDR-SDRAM (single channel) | 16.8 Gbit/s | 2.1 GB/s | ||
PC3200 DDR-SDRAM (single channel) | 25.6 Gbit/s | 3.2 GB/s | ||
PC2100 DDR-SDRAM (dual channel) | 33.6 Gbit/s | 4.2 GB/s | ||
PC3200 DDR-SDRAM (dual channel) | 51.2 Gbit/s | 6.4 GB/s |
